Understanding the 2006 Chrysler 300 Stereo Wiring Diagram

A 2006 Chrysler 300 stereo wiring diagram is essentially a blueprint that illustrates how the electrical components of your car's audio system are connected. It shows the pathways for power, ground, speaker outputs, accessory signals, and any other necessary connections for the factory or aftermarket stereo to function. Think of it as a roadmap for every wire running to and from your head unit, amplifiers, and speakers.

These diagrams are incredibly useful for a variety of tasks. For DIY enthusiasts looking to install a new stereo, replace a faulty unit, or add features like Bluetooth connectivity, the diagram is indispensable. It helps identify:

  • The correct wires for constant power (always on).
  • The accessory power wire (turns on with the ignition).
  • The ground wire for a secure connection.
  • The speaker wires for each individual speaker (positive and negative).
  • Antenna control and illumination signals.

Without a proper 2006 Chrysler 300 stereo wiring diagram, guesswork can lead to blown fuses, damaged components, or a non-functional stereo. The importance of using an accurate diagram cannot be overstated for a safe and successful installation.
